How to increase disk space for a domain in Linux reseller account

August 9, 2024 / Domain and DNS

In this guide, you will learn how increasing disk space for a domain hosted under your Linux reseller account is necessary when the current allocation is insufficient to accommodate the domain’s data, ensuring uninterrupted website functionality and preventing issues like the “Disk Quota Exceeded” error.

Let us follow the steps:

  1. Log in to the WHM panel.
  2. In the WHM search box, type “List Accounts” and click on the corresponding menu option. list account
  3. Scroll down to locate the domain name for which you need to increase disk space, or use the search box to find your domain name.
  4. Click the “+” symbol next to the domain name to reveal additional options. +symbol
  5. Then click the “Modify Account” button. modify account
  6. Scroll down to the “Resource Limits” section and adjust the disk quota as needed. disk space quota (MB)
  7. After making the necessary changes, click the “Save” button to apply the updates to the domain on the server.
